President's T's

Sirs:

TIME, Oct. 6, ''President Hoover dotted his last "i's," crossed in his last "t's." . . .

Are you inferring that President Hoover writes his speeches hastily, then goes over them and crosses "t's,'' dots "i's"? I doubt it.

EUNICE E. BRAATEN

Dedham, Mass.

As a matter of fact (though TIME did not intend to infer it) the President is known to do much meticulous revising of his speeches.—ED.
